forsythiahill:

Last nights Beaver Moon lunar eclipse as the Earth gets in between the sun and moon and gradually casts its shadow over the Moon. My photos began around 2:30 am - just after 4 am EST.

This phenomenon has not occurred in 580 years and we’ll all be long dead when the next one like this comes around again.

It was very still outside but I did hear what seemed to be a little fox yipping or was it something else trying to HOWL at the waning MOON?
